DMDE
DMDE

Description: DMDE is a powerful software for data recovery and undelete operations on disks and partitions. It can recover deleted files and lost partitions even after reformatting disks. Useful for both home and professional use.

DMDE
DMDE Features
  • Recovers deleted files and folders
  • Recovers data after formatting or repartitioning
  • Supports FAT, exFAT, NTFS, ReFS, HFS+, APFS, Ext2/3/4, BtrFS, XFS, JFS, UFS file systems
  • Has file search and file carving capabilities
  • Creates disk images for recovery
  • Supports RAID recovery
  • Has a hex editor for low-level data access
  • Works with logical and physical drives
